(popping in) Kathye, For the Foleypro OBP file, instead of trying to import it, create a new folder in your Objects Library called Foleypro, then drop the OBP into it. I can't recall if the OBP has Bryce trees in it (Brian?) but if it does, I cannot import or export OBPs that have Bryce trees in it, but I can install them directly to the Objects Library and open them just fine from within Bryce. This might be what is happening for you as well. -darlisa
